WebOct 24, 2024 · You have the option of birthing at the birth centre (located at Belmont Hospital) or at home. A small team of experienced midwives provide all your care during pregnancy, birth and up to two weeks after your baby is born. There are no obstetricians onsite. The Belmont midwives are supported by medical specialists at John Hunter Hospital. WebThe birth centres specialise in natural delivery and provide access to showers, baths, birthing stools and other aids, but offer minimal pharmaceutical pain relief.

WebYou must register the birth of your baby. This is a requirement by the births, deaths and marriages registry in your state or territory. The hospital will give you a birth registration form. There's no cost for registering the birth of your newborn. When you do this, you may want to purchase a birth certificate for your baby. WebDec 12, 2012 · Background To determine the rates of birth registration over a five-year period in New South Wales (NSW) and explore the factors associated with the rate of registration. Methods This is a cross-sectional study using linked population databases.
